Cursor and text problems in ProE

I have a number of users complaining that when they are editing text in
a properties dialog the cursor does not maintain its alignment with the
text in the dialog box as they use their arrow keys. As a result they
are often deleting or changing the wrong text in the dialog box.

Initially the cursor seems to be aligned properly, but as you move the
cursor character to character, it begins to encroach on the letters and
will appear right on top of a character. I have seen this in the past,
but nothing I tried at the time seemed to help. Has anyone else
experienced this and found the root cause?

We are on ProE 2001/Ilink 3.0 on IBM ThinkCentre/WinXP/ATI

    I have seen this. This started when we updated one of the Windows
    Updates. it seems to be to be Graphics card/ update issue.
    We had 6 users all update at the same time, two of us, who had identical
    machines had the problem. Only his windows updated went seamlessly and he
    could
    go back to the prior update. & lucky me, mine crashed after it loaded, and
    the UNDO option was gone on mine..they were going to have to totally
    re-install the operating system on my machine to go back...

    the only other fix is save & reboot.. when you come back it will be okay,
    for a while..

    They will also see the problem in other programs the more they use them..
    it makes typing emails and reports fun too!!
